Description
From the lavish diplomatic circles of Buenos Aires to the harsh realities of life as an abandoned teenager in Atlanta, Stephanie's story is a testament to the resilience of the human spirit. As the daughter of a former Air Force pilot turned diplomat, she lived a life of privilege, complete with maids, chauffeurs, and the expectations of perfection. But beneath the sophisticated veneer lay a family dynamic filled with emotional distance and mounting dysfunction. When her father abandons her at a crisis center, declaring her 'incorrigible,' Stephanie begins a harrowing journey through trauma that would break most spirits. Yet, through her remarkable journey of survival, she shows an extraordinary capacity to endure and find hope in the darkest of circumstances. Her unique perspective, moving from the highest echelons of diplomatic society to the struggles of navigating life alone, offers readers an unprecedented view of both worlds and the strength and courage required to survive in each.
'Vestiges of Light' is more than a memoir - it's a beacon of hope for anyone who has ever felt abandoned, lost, or betrayed by those they trusted most. This compelling narrative shows that even in our darkest moments, there are always vestiges of light guiding us toward survival and healing.
